1. Adobe Firefly
FreemiumFree tierAdobe's commercially safe AI image generation integrated into Photoshop, Illustrator, and Creative Cloud — trained on licensed stock content
Why choose Adobe Firefly over Ideogram?
Offers unique capabilities like generative fill: add, remove, or replace objects in photoshop with ai and generative expand: extend canvas edges intelligently.
Key Features
- ★Generative Fill: add, remove, or replace objects in Photoshop with AI(unique)
- ★Generative Expand: extend canvas edges intelligently(unique)
- ★Text to Image via web app or integrated into CC apps(unique)
- ★Text Effects: style text with AI-generated visual treatments in Illustrator(unique)
- ★Generative Recolor for Illustrator vector artwork(unique)
- ★Trained on licensed Adobe Stock — commercially safe outputs(unique)

2. Leonardo AI
FreemiumFree tierAI image generator with fine-tunable models for game art, concept art, and brand-consistent visuals — plus animation and canvas tools
Why choose Leonardo AI over Ideogram?
Offers unique capabilities like 40+ fine-tuned models for different art styles and use cases and custom model fine-tuning on your own reference images.
Key Features
- ★40+ fine-tuned models for different art styles and use cases(unique)
- ★Custom model fine-tuning on your own reference images(unique)
- ★AI Canvas with inpainting, outpainting, and sketch-to-image(unique)
- ★Motion: animate still images into short video clips(unique)
- ★Alchemy V2 upscaling and quality enhancement(unique)
- ★Phoenix: Leonardo's flagship multimodal image model(unique)

4. Stable Diffusion
Open SourceFree tierOpen-source AI image generator with full control
Why choose Stable Diffusion over Ideogram?
Stable Diffusion is open-source, giving you full control and customization. Paid plans start lower at $0.002/mo compared to Ideogram's $8/mo. Stable Diffusion brings a image generation perspective, useful if you need cross-domain capabilities.
Key Features
- ★Run locally(unique)
- ★Custom models(unique)
- ★LoRA support(unique)
- ★ControlNet(unique)
- ★Inpainting/outpainting(unique)
- ★Commercial license(unique)
